Transaction 17071393678ea2bea8a5b774593e67c3ec77e219cc154a69a604c0967d5fb9b1
1 Input
1 Output
-
17071393678ea2bea8a5b774593e67c3ec77e219cc154a69a604c0967d5fb9b1: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d7d8d86d7c78e20c8825a0636ca6babcb6d06556b26db85a75e3e6defe99ba27
- address
- bc1p6lvdsmtu0r3qezp95p3kef46hjmdqe2kkfkmskn4u0ndal5ehgnsfw68xd